Reaching the Premier League after selling £140m worth of players is remarkable but investment is need if an immediate relegation is to be avoided

When Leeds United sold £140m of playing talent last summer, Daniel Farke deviated from accepted managerial convention and declined to throw his toys out of the pram. Farke is a little too unconventional, a little too resistant to groupthink, to always do the expected and his club’s owner, the San Francisco-based 49er Enterprises, is set to reap the benefits.

The German’s unusual amalgam of high emotional intelligence and advanced numeracy have helped provide the framework for the freshly secured promotion to the Premier League Leeds so narrowly missed out on last May.
